Opportunities for in-line, transistorbased technologies on MV and LV power distribution networks
[摘要] ENGLISH ABSTRACT:Once more opportunities exist for innovative technologies to be applied on MV and LVpower distribution networks to meet the new challenges set by government through itsNational Electrification Programme (NEP) to electrify a further 2,5 million households ofwhich a large majority are in low-density rural areas. Electronic means of voltagecompensation of long MV and LV networks supplying these low-density rural areas are nowpossible in the form of electronic voltage regulators mounted on the secondary side ofdistribution transformers and service connection boxes along the LV feeders.Furthermore, it is now possible to provide remote rural agricultural customers with singlephasesupplies supported by end-use technologies in the form of electronic phase convertersthat eliminate the need for three-phase supplies. This hybrid of supply- and end-usetechnologies together with Eskom's self-build policy has made the dream of Eskom gridpower a reality.
